What Are Estate Vintage Bracelets?
Estate vintage bracelets are pre-owned pieces, often decades old, that reflect the design sensibilities of their era—be it Art Deco, Edwardian, or Mid-Century Modern. These bracelets are prized for:
-
Unique craftsmanship and hand-set stones
-
Historical value and provenance
-
Rare materials like old European cut diamonds, platinum, and natural sapphires
-
Sustainability, as they promote reuse over new mining

1. How Can You Tell If a Bracelet Is Truly Vintage or Estate?
A bracelet is considered estate if it has been previously owned, and vintage if it’s typically over 20–30 years old. To verify authenticity:
-
Look for hallmarks or maker’s marks stamped on the metal.
-
Examine the design style—Art Deco, Victorian, or Retro styles often indicate age.
-
Check for natural wear and craftsmanship details like hand-set stones or filigree work. Professional appraisal or certification can confirm the era and value of the piece.

4. What’s the Difference Between Antique, Vintage, and Estate Jewelry?
-
Antique: Over 100 years old.
-
Vintage: Typically 20–100 years old.
-
Estate: Pre-owned, regardless of age. So, a bracelet can be estate and vintage, or even estate and antique. The terms reflect age and ownership, not necessarily quality or style.
5. How Should You Care for Estate Vintage Bracelets?
To preserve your vintage bracelet:
-
Clean gently with a soft cloth and avoid harsh chemicals.
-
Store in a padded jewelry box away from direct sunlight.
-
Avoid wearing during heavy activity to prevent damage. Professional cleaning and occasional inspections help maintain its beauty and integrity.
